The older 6 speed boxes (prior to 2004 ish) on the MK1 Fabia vRS and other PD130 cars had a very long 6th gear and was much higher geared than the 5 speed.

 

Since then that's changed and basically the 6 speed boxes usually have the same top gear ratio just more gears crammed in to give you a wider spread of ratios.

 

I also know that my 6 speed DSG revs at the same RPM at 70 mph as a 5 speed manual version.

 

You would need to find the specs on your gearbox and the proposed replacement and look up the final drive ratios to see if there's any difference and benefit in doing it.
